Prakash Jha's Ek Badnaam Aashram Season 3 Part 2 promises high-octane drama as it delves into a gripping tale of faith, power, and betrayal.
Last Updated: 04.13 PM, Feb 12, 2025
With the highly anticipated premiere of the second part of Season 3 soon on Amazon MX Player, Ek Badnaam Aashram, one of India's most-watched OTT shows, is all prepared to take over screens once again. Today's unveiling of an explosive teaser for the upcoming season revived the enthusiasm and fandom for the series that has enchanted people throughout India. With Bobby Deol at the helm, this gripping crime drama co-written and produced by Prakash Jha boasts an A-list ensemble cast that includes Chandan Roy Sanyal, Tridha Choudhury, Darshan Kumaar, Vikram Kochhar, Anupriya Goenka, Rajeev Siddhartha, Esha Gupta, and Aaditi Pohankar.
The disturbing tension between Baba Nirala's inner circle, the steadfast devotion of his followers, and the terrifying return to power are all glimpsed in the teaser. In the midst of long-buried secrets and impending betrayals, a new chapter begins in the gripping story of redemption, betrayal, and revenge, centring on Pammi and Bhopa. Using the score from Duniya Mein Logon Ko, which sets the stage for an exhilarating season, makes the teaser even more captivating and exciting. With fans' expectations already skyrocketing, Ek Badnaam Aashram Season 3-Part 2 will reportedly take things to the next level by revealing dark secrets and fierce rivalries.
